Federal Reserve Chairman Walsh refused to disclose whether he will raise interest rates in July. On July 1st, according to Golden Ten Data, Federal Reserve Chairman Walsh avoided questions about whether the Fed may raise interest rates at its July meeting. I hope we can have a thorough 'family internal debate' when we meet in four weeks, "he said." When we meet behind closed doors, we will have intense debates. But beyond that, I have no more information to disclose. "Walsh made the above remarks at the European Central Bank's annual policy seminar held in Sintra, Portugal; This is his first public appearance since attending the Federal Reserve press conference last month. Since then, investors have begun to expect the Federal Reserve to raise interest rates more frequently, but the market currently expects the likelihood of the first rate hike this month to be less than 50%.
